"And He taught Adam the names of all things; thereafter He placed those things before the angels;
and said: "Tell Me the names of these if you are truthful {about your saying about Adam}"
They said, "Glory is for You; We don't have the knowledge; we know only what you taught us" {Refer 02:31-32} The angles had given their opinion/observation with regard to human's future conduct when they were told that Adam is being given freedom on earth, . It was merely an opinion/presumption not based on complete knowledge. After making the Adam know the names of all things the same were presented before the Angles and were asked to name them to prove that whatever that had opined was based on comprehensive knowledge. Truthful is only he who makes a statement based on complete knowledge; a statement based on incomplete information/data does not rise to the level of truth; it is merely an opinion not worthy to be treated as truth at the given point of time. But at the same time it is not a lie since it is based on some data/information and is not merely an imaginative assertion. The opinion would prove either to be correct or wrong only at a point in time later than it was expressed when further data/information/conduct becomes visible. That is why scientists do not lie, they opine whereas philosophers do lie when they base study on a presumption/imagination/myth. Scientists never waste the time of humanity; philosophers do. The things were lying right before their eyes yet thay said, "We do not have the knowledge". Knowledge begins not by seeing things but from the point when we know its name/code. Knowledge of anything is obtained first by knowing the name/code of the thing which enables its storage/preservation in the memory. If we do not know the name/code, the physical appearance of any thing in our focus of eye {vision} does not have any significance since it will not let that thing be captivated in the brain as memory. Name/code is THE PRIMARY thing to acquire knowledge. A code of a thing enables a man to perceive the thing in his vision {in metaphorical meanings of بصر}. Quran e Majeed had informed mankind, 1400 years back, as follows:
"We will keep making it visible to the eyes of those who do not accept Quran, the signs/knowledge in the Universe and in their own bodies till it becomes evident for them that this Quran is a statement of proven fact" {Refer 41:53} The Grand Quran has informed that Allah will keep revealing, the knowledge about the universe and human body, and it will become manifest to the people that the Quran is a statement of proven fact. Why would it become manifest that the Quran is a statement of proven fact when man sees/perceives new knowledge about universe and human body? If the things mentioned in a book written earlier in time and space are subsequently found a scientific fact only then it is evident to people that the Book is really a statement of proven facts and not conjectural and presumptive. One may reflect why the Grand Quran has made this tall claim that knowledge of the universe and human body will keep revealing and the words of Quran will keep proving to be a proven fact? Knowledge is primarily divided into two branches; knowledge of things/matter and what happened/was talked about by the people/their dialogues/habits/acts in the past. The knowledge about the matter is verifiable in time and space. Anything said by anyone/book regarding physical matters could be subjected to verification in time and space about its truth to an exact detail. If we find the words of a book relating to physical matters written earlier in time as true and factually and materially correct in all respects then we will have to believe too in those statements of the Book which narrate some events/dialogues between people of past/historical statements. The falsification test of any book/statement could be the physical one. The facts mentioned in the Quran about the Universe and human body is in itself also the falsification test of the Book.
